Server Driver for NetWare 4.11



   Introduction:

   -------------

   This document describes the procedure to install the NetWare v4.11

   server driver for REALTEK RTL8139 Fast Ethernet adapter.



   Location of Driver:     \NWSERVER\411\RTSSRV.LAN



   Installaton Procedure :

   ---------------------

      Before you start with the installation  process,  make sure that

      the Novell NetWare v4.11 server is properly installed.

      Similarly, your adapter should also be properly installed in your

      server.

      1. Insert the Realtek Driver Diskette into drive A and check the

         contents of subdirectory  \NWSERVER\411, It should contain the

         following file :



         RTSSRV.LANÄÄÄ  Novell NetWare V4.11 Server Driver

         RTSSRV.LDIÄÄÄ  Novell NetWare V4.11 Server Driver Installation

                        Information File



      2. At the  NetWare prompt (indicated by the Server name), run the

         INSTALL.NLM program by typing:



         server name: LOAD INSTALL <Enter>



      3. Select "Maintenance/Selective Install" and press <Enter>.



      4. Select  " LAN Driver Options (Configure/Load/...) "  and press

         <Enter>.



      5. Press the <Ins> key to specify other drivers to install.



      6. Press  <F3>  and specify the driver path (A:\NWSERVER\411)

         and press <Enter>.



      7. The RTSSRV.LAN driver should appear in your choice list for the

         'Select a  LAN  Driver' field. Choose this  driver to start the

         driver loading and  binding  procedure.  This will allow you to

         load and bind all 4 frame types supported by NetWare.



      8. Add the LOAD and BIND statements you require to the server's

         AUTOEXEC.NCF file so that the LAN driver will load automatically

         each time the server starts up.





      Installation Notes:

      -------------------

      1.Installing Multiple LAN Adapters:

         The keyword  "SLOT"  is  provided for multiple LAN adapters in a

         single server by the driver RTSSRV.LAN.  So, add EtherID in LOAD

         commands. For example:



         LOAD RTSSRV F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=LAN_A SLOT=1

         BIND IPX TO LAN_A NET=11

         LOAD RTSSRV F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=LAN_B SLOT=2

         BIND IPX TO LAN_B NET=22



      2. The keyword  "SPEED"  is  provided for specifying adapter's speed

         (10M/100M), add SPEED in LOAD commands. For example:



         LOAD RTSSRV F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=LAN_A SLOT=1 SPEED=100

         BIND IPX TO LAN_A NET=11
